  Delta State Government wishes to correct a misleading information regarding the autonomous status of Olodu community in Aniocha South Local Government Area of Delta State. We clarify that a memo seeking autonomy for the community was listed as one of the memos to be considered at the maiden 2025 meeting of the State Executive Council yesterday but was stepped down on the directive of His Excellency, the Governor, Rt Honorable (Elder) Sheriff Oborevwori before the commencement of proceedings.   Delta State Government, at its maiden Executive Council (EXCO) meeting for 2025, has approved over N275 billion for the execution of 76 projects spanning different sectors across the three senatorial districts of the state. The approval was given at the Exco meeting on Thursday, presided over by Governor Sheriff Oborevwori at Government House, Asaba. The Commissioner for Works (Rural Roads) and Public Information, Mr Charles Aniagwu, who briefed the press after the meeting, said the approvals were record-breaking, outstanding and deafening to critics.
